volume of any sphere = (4 / 3) * pi (a constant 3.14159) * radius cubed

so if radius = say 2 cm, volume = 33.51

so if radius = 4 cm, volume = 268.08

so if you double the radius, you (2)^3= 8 times the volume

and if you treble the radius, you (3)^3 = 27 times the volume
